Comparação da placa de vídeo Gainward GeForce RTX 3080 Phoenix GS versus placa de vídeo GIGABYTE AORUS GeForce RTX 3080 Xtreme Waterforce WB 10G por especificações e benchmarks. Gainward GeForce RTX 3080 Phoenix GS roda na velocidade base de 1.440 GHz e tem 10 GB de memória GDDR6X, enquanto a placa de vídeo GIGABYTE AORUS GeForce RTX 3080 Xtreme Waterforce WB 10G roda na velocidade base de 1.440 GHz e tem 10 GB de memória GDDR6X. O peso é diferente, -- vs --. O TDP da primeira placa de vídeo é 320 W e a segunda é 320 W . Compare os resultados do benchmark para descobrir qual placa de vídeo é melhor.
